Church
or the Scandinavian Seamen's Church is a historical building located in Park Lane, , , England. It consists of a church, built between 1883 and 1884, and an attached minister's house, and provides a centre for the Liverpool International Nordic Community. is situated 860 feet south of Duke Street Food & Drink Market.
